If you have a network driver installed, File Manager enables the "Disk\Connect Net Drive..." and "Disk\Disconnect Net Drive..." menu items. When you use "Disk\Connect Net Drive..." you get a dialog prompting you for what drive to connect and what network file service to connect to. This dialog also has a "Add to Previous List" check box and a "Previous..." button. These work in conjuction to provide the ability so save connections for use in future sessions. This list is kept in the [previous] section in your WINFILE.INI file.
